In the first September, the added value of chemical raw materials and products manufacturing increased by 10.8% year-on-year

According to the data released by the National Bureau of statistics on October 18, in September, the added value of industries above designated size increased by 3.1% year-on-year, 10.2% over the same period in 2019, and an average increase of 5.0% over the two years. In September, the industrial added value increased by 0.05% over the previous month. Among them, the chemical raw materials and chemical products manufacturing industry were flat year-on-year.

Divided into three categories, in September, the added value of the mining industry increased by 3.2% year-on-year; The manufacturing industry increased by 2.4%; The production and supply of electricity, heat, gas and water increased by 9.7%.
